What does Town of Houston spend the most on?
Based on 243 tracked contracts, Town of Houston spends most on Capital Projects (143), Public Works (50), Recreation & Community Services (21), Environmental Services (16), and Library (13). Contract types include FINANCIAL_SERVICES, FACILITIES, OTHER, PROFESSIONAL_SERVICES, and Service. Who are Town of Houston's current vendors?
Town of Houston currently works with vendors including STATE OF MINNESOTA, WM, CARL & VERNA SCHMIDT FOUNDATION, BOLTON & MENK, HOMETOWN PRIDE, BOLTON & MENK INC., SELCO, IOC, TURF MAINTENANCE, and SMIF. These vendors span contract types like FINANCIAL_SERVICES, FACILITIES, OTHER, PROFESSIONAL_SERVICES, and Service.
